    Unless you are a trained contractor, the majority of roofing work should never be undertaken yourself. In addition always remember that a large number of manufacturers of products utilized in the repair of the roof will not warranty those items unless a certified professional carries out the job. Something else to remember is that working on a roof may be very risky, so is it really worth risking your health in order to save money?

    Since your roof is consistently subjected to the weather, it means your roof is going to degrade with time. The speed at which it degrades will be dependent on a number of factors. Those include; the grade of the initial materials used along with the craftsmanship, the level of abuse it has to take from the weather, how well the roof is maintained and the type of roof. Most roofing contractors will estimate around 20 years for a well-built and well-kept roof, but that can never be guaranteed due to the above issues. Our suggestion is to consistently keep your roof well maintained and get regular inspections to be sure it lasts as long as possible.

    You should never pressure wash your roof, as you run the risk of getting rid of any covering minerals that have been added to offer cover from the weather. On top of that, you should steer clear of chlorine-based bleach cleaning products since they can easily also cut down the life-span of your roof. When you talk to your roof cleaning expert, ask them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to clean your roof. This will get rid of the aesthetically displeasing algae and staining without ruining the tile or shingles.

    How To Choose A Reliable Roofing Company For Your Home

    aluminum-roofing-in
    The primary function of your roof would be to shelter your family through the rain, wind, snow, and harsh summer sun. Developing a well-maintained roof is vital in order to create a home that is certainly safe and comfortable.

    Unfortunately, roofing materials don’t last forever. All roofs must be repaired or replaced at one point or other. Unless you will find the right tools and experience to complete the task yourself, that usually means employing a professional roofer.

    The necessity of hiring the right company can’t be overstated. Most roofing projects are very expensive. You have to know that you are investing your hard earned dollars wisely which the finished roof may last for many years to come. Take a look at these tips on how to get a reliable roofer for your house:

    1. Work with a local company. Before getting a contractor, make sure that they have a physical address in your city or county. Local contractors will probably be familiar with the codes and building requirements in your town. Also, they are less likely to attempt to scam you out of your money since they have to maintain their reputation in your community.

    2. Verify that this contractor is licensed and insured. Reputable contractors always make time to get licensed. You should be able to look up licensing information online throughout the website of the city or state. Check to make sure that the contractor’s license applies and that it is current prior to getting them. Additionally, ask the contractor to deliver evidence of liability insurance and worker’s compensation insurance before they begin work.

    3. Solicit competing quotes. Don’t make the mistake of hiring the very first company that you just contact. Instead, get in touch with at least some different contractors in your community to obtain quotes for that roofing project. Ask each contractor to present you with an itemized quote to enable you to see just where your money goes. Ideally, they must send an agent in your property to check the roof directly before giving you an estimate. Doing this, the estimate they supply will be much more accurate.

    4. Be sure the clients are trustworthy by reading through reviews using their past clients. Consider checking with groups much like the Better Business Bureau (BBB) to confirm that no major complaints have already been filed against them.

    5. Get all things in writing. Don’t simply take a contractor at their word. Instead, inquire further to present you a written contract. Make certain both you together with the contractor sign the contract. Have a copy yourself in the event that any problems or disputes arise. A signed contract reduces the chance of misunderstandings and offers you legal protection if the contractor fails to adhere to through on their promises.

    Choosing a reliable roofer for your house is very important. The roof is probably the most important components of your house. Hiring a professional roofing contractor who may have an excellent reputation is the simplest way to ensure that the project goes as planned.
